If a+4/a = 4 then find the value of a^5-1/a^5
pls answer this one as quick as possible.
Value of [tex]a^5-\frac{1}{a^5}[/tex] is 31.97.
What do you mean by algebraic expression?
In mathematics, an expression that incorporates variables, constants, and algebraic operations is known as an algebraic expression (addition, subtraction, etc.). Terms comprise expressions.
There are 3 main types of algebraic expressions which include:
Monomial Expression
Binomial Expression
Polynomial Expression
An algebraic expression which is having only one term is known as a monomial.
Given expression:
a + 4/a = 4
We need to simplify the above expression and will find the value of a.
[tex]a+\frac{4}{a}=4[/tex]
⇒ [tex]\frac{a^2+4}{a}=4[/tex]
⇒ [tex]a^{2}+4=4a[/tex]
⇒ [tex]a^2-4a+4=0[/tex]
⇒ [tex]a^2-2a-2a+4=0[/tex]
⇒ a(a-2) -2(a-2) = 0
⇒ (a-2)(a-2) = 0
⇒ a = 2
Now, substitute this value of a in expression , [tex]a^5-\frac{1}{a^5}[/tex]
[tex]2^5-\frac{1}{2^5}[/tex]
= 32 - 1/32
= [tex]\frac{1024-1}{32} =1023/32 = 31.97[/tex]
Therefore, value of [tex]a^5-\frac{1}{a^5}[/tex] is 31.97.

Fig. 3.3 shows an equilateral triangle with the lengths of its sides given in terms of x and y. Find the values of x and y. A 4x cm B 3y cm C (x + y + 5) cm
The values of x and y are 3 and 4.
Given:
shows an equilateral triangle with the lengths of its sides given in terms of x and y.
A 4x cm B 3y cm C (x + y + 5) cm
In equilateral triangle all sides are equal:
4x = 3y = x+y+5
4x = 3y
4x - 3y = 0. ---------eq(1)
4x = x + y + 5
3x - y = 5. ----------eq(2)
solving eq 1 - eq 2*3 we get,
4x - 3y - 9x + 3y = 0 - 15
-5x = -15
x = 3
4x - 3y = 0
4*3 - 3y = 0
12 = 3y
y = 12/3
y = 4
Therefore The values of x and y are 3 and 4.

Wyatt is deciding between two different movie streaming sites to subscribe to. Plan A costs $19 per month plus $0.50 per movie watched. Plan B costs $13 per month plus $1.50 per movie watched. Let A represent the monthly cost of Plan A if Wyatt watches x per month, and let B represent the monthly cost of Plan B if Wyatt watches a movies per month. Write an equation for each situation, in terms of x, and determine the number of monthly movies watched, x, that would make the two plans have an equal monthly cost.
Equations representing the total costs for plan A and B are A = 19 + 0.50x and B = 13 + 1.5x, respectively, where x is the number of movies watches.
Cost of both the plans will be equal for 6 movies.
What is a linear equation?A linear function is defined as a function that has either one or two variables without exponents.
Given that, Wyatt is deciding between two different film streaming sites to subscribe to, plan A costs $19 per month plus $0.50 per film watched, plan B costs $13 per month plus $1.50 per film watched.
According to question,
A = 19 + 0.50x and
B = 13 + 1.5x
For costs being equal, we have,
A = B
19 + 0.50x = 13 + 1.5x
x = 6
Hence, for 6 films the costs of both the plans will be equal and equation for both the plans are A = 19 + 0.50x and B = 13 + 1.5x

The town of Wattle has a population that is decreasing steadily.
It is found that the population is decreasing at a rate of 5.4% per year.
How long will it take for the population to be beneath 45% of what it is now?
Answer:
After 1 yr P1 = .946 Po
After 2 yrs P = .946 P1 = .946^2 Po
After n yrs P = .946^n Po
.45 = .946^n What is n needed to drop P to .45 P
log .45 = n log .946
n = log .45 / log .946 = -.347 /-.0241 = 14.4 years

shopper needs 48 hot dogs. The store sells identical hot dogs in 2 differently sized packages. They sell a six-pack of hot dogs for $2.10, and an eight-pack of hot dogs for $3.12.
The pack of hot dogs that the shopper should buy that would be cheaper is six - pack of hot dogs
How to find the pack to be bought?If the shopper decided to buy the six-pack of hot dogs for $2.10, their total cost to be able to get 48 hot dogs would be:
= Cost per six pack of hot dogs x ( Number of hot dogs needed / Number of hot dogs in pack)
=2.10 x (48 / 6)
= 2.10 x 8
= $16.80
The cost if the shopper wants the eight pack is:
= 3.12 x (48 / 8)
= $18.72
The shopper should pick the six - pack of hot dogs because it is cheaper.
